Feed binders are substances that are added to animal feed to help the feed maintain its shape and form, making it easier to handle and transport. Feed binders also improve the nutritional value of feed and ensure that it is consumed entirely by animals, thereby reducing feed wastage.


Plant-based feed binders, such as guar gum, pectin, and cellulose, are widely used in animal feed as they are natural, easily available, and cost-effective. Clay-based feed binders, such as bentonite and montmorillonite, are also popular due to their ability to improve feed quality and reduce digestive problems in animals. Molasses is commonly used as a binder in cattle feed, while wheat gluten is used in poultry and pig feed.


The global feed binders market is expected to grow at a significant pace in the coming years, driven by the increasing consumption of animal meat, increasing focus on animal health and nutrition, and the growth of the animal husbandry industry. According to the FAO, food demand is expected to increase by 60% by 2050, with animal proteins expected to rise at 1.7 percent per year.


However, the increasing cost of raw materials of feed binders is expected to hamper the feed binders market growth. Binding agents are highly effective binders but are very expensive to include in the feed. To optimize the cost of feed ingredients, compound feed mixers, or livestock, farmers opt for binders with high-cohesive properties to reduce the amount of inclusion as well as to limit the cost.


The high demand for feed binders in the poultry feed industry in Asia Pacific is a major factor driving the growth of the Asia Pacific feed binders market. According to the OECD-FAO, India's consumption of poultry meat has been steadily increasing and it went from 3,428.04 thousand tons in 2016 to 3,819.24 thousand tons in 2019.
